The contract award pertains to the procurement of dairy products for federal institutional use under the FY26 4TH QTR DAIRY AWARDS, issued by the Federal Correctional Institution at Elkton, Ohio, under the Department of Justice. The solicitation number is 15B21626P00000073, posted on July 7, 2026, with a total estimated value of $63,462.80, encompassing two line items: 60 units of reduced-fat sour cream at $10.00 per 5-pound container and 204,100 units of pasteurized whole milk at $0.3080 per ½ pint container. All products must conform strictly to federal standards, including CID A-A-20251 for sour cream and CID A-A-20338A for milk, alongside compliance with 21 CFR §131.110 for the standard of identity for milk, with no substitutions permitted. Deliveries are required to be made to ELKTON, OH 44415, with acceptance occurring at that location, and products must originate from the United States or Canada unless otherwise permitted. Packaging must adhere to specified container types and sizes but no additional requirements for labeling, barcoding, or preservation beyond pasteurization are detailed.
